Overview
We are seeking a hands-on Accounting Manager to support the Controller with month-end close execution and day-to-day accounting operations across a multi-entity organization. This role focuses on reconciliations, journal entries, intercompany accounting, accounts payable oversight, audit and tax support, and improving accounting processes and close efficiency.
The ideal candidate is detail-oriented, organized, and comfortable working in a structured, deadline-driven environment with a practical understanding of U.S. GAAP and operational accounting. Responsibilities
Support execution of the month-end close process, ensuring timely and accurate financial reporting
Prepare and review journal entries, account reconciliations, and supporting schedules
Support preparation of monthly financial statements and maintain organized close documentation
Record and reconcile intercompany transactions across multiple entities and maintain supporting documentation
Support and supervise the Accounts Payable Specialist, including workflow coordination and month-end AP activities
Apply a working knowledge of U.S. GAAP and support the Controller on non-routine accounting matters as needed
Assist with year-end audit preparation, auditor requests, tax filings, extensions, and payment tracking
Support internal controls, accounting policy adherence, and process consistency across entities
Identify opportunities to improve efficiency, reduce manual work, and streamline the month-end close process
Analyze accounting activity and reporting trends to identify issues and support process improvements
Communicate accounting matters clearly and collaborate effectively across teams
